The military court sentenced a red-shirt businessman accused of posting content defaming the monarchy on Facebook to 50 years imprisonment, in a trial held in camera, but the jail term was halved because the suspect pleaded guilty.    The man, who wants to remain anonymous and whose given name begins with T and surname with S, was accused of using two Facebook accounts under the name “Yai Daengdueat”.

Thai police have arrested a businessman for posting lèse majesté messages on his Facebook account. The man, whose given name begins with T and surname with S, was accused of using two Facebook accounts under  “Yai Daengdueat” (ใหญ่ แดงเดือด) to post three messages deemed to defame the King, according to the police custody petition submitted to the military court on Thursday.
